A Complete Guide to Indiana University of Pennsylvania

1. Introduction

Indiana University of Pennsylvania (IUP) stands as a beacon of higher education in Pennsylvania, known for its rich history, diverse academic programs, and commitment to student success. Founded in 1875 as a teacher’s college, IUP has evolved into a comprehensive university offering a wide range of undergraduate, graduate, and doctoral programs. With a strong emphasis on research, innovation, and community engagement, IUP continues to play a crucial role in shaping the future of its students and contributing to the local and global community.

2. Campus and Facilities

IUP’s main campus is located in the town of Indiana, Pennsylvania, nestled in the picturesque Allegheny Mountains. The campus is a blend of historic buildings and modern facilities, creating an environment that is both inspiring and conducive to learning. The Oak Grove, a central green space surrounded by towering oak trees, serves as the heart of the campus, where students gather for events, study, or simply relax between classes.

In addition to the main campus, IUP has several satellite campuses and extension sites, including the Punxsutawney, Northpointe, and Monroeville campuses. These sites provide students with greater flexibility and access to IUP’s programs, particularly for non-traditional students or those living in different regions.

Notable buildings on the main campus include the Eberly College of Business and Information Technology, the new science building, and the Kovalchick Convention and Athletic Complex, which hosts a variety of events, from academic conferences to sports games. Student housing options range from traditional dormitories to modern apartment-style living, ensuring that all students can find a home that suits their needs.

6. Athletics and Recreation

IUP is home to a thriving athletics program, with 19 varsity sports teams competing in the NCAA Division II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ference (PSAC). The Crimson Hawks, as the teams are known, have a strong tradition of excellence, with numerous conference championships and national tournament appearances.

In addition to varsity sports, IUP offers a variety of intramural and club sports, providing students with the opportunity to stay active and compete in a more casual setting. The university’s fitness centers and recreational facilities are state-of-the-art, featuring everything from weight rooms and cardio equipment to swimming pools and climbing walls.

Notable achievements in IUP athletics include the men’s basketball team’s multiple appearances in the NCAA Division II Final Four and the women’s field hockey team’s PSAC championships. These successes are a testament to the dedication and hard work of IUP’s student-athletes and coaches.

8. Alumni Network

The IUP alumni network is a vibrant and active community, with more than 150,000 graduates spread across the globe. These alumni are leaders in their fields, making significant contributions in industries such as business, education, healthcare, and public service. Notable alumni include Chad Hurley, co-founder of YouTube, and Jackie Sherrill, a legendary college football coach.
